diff --git a/pom.xml b/pom.xml
index 41e6b6a..15a3714 100644
--- a/pom.xml
+++ b/pom.xml
@@ -76,7 +76,7 @@
io.quarkus
- quarkus-jdbc-mysql
+ quarkus-jdbc-postgresql
diff --git a/src/main/resources/application.properties b/src/main/resources/application.properties
index 9f331e8..6045e57 100644
--- a/src/main/resources/application.properties
+++ b/src/main/resources/application.properties
@@ -2,10 +2,10 @@ quarkus.swagger-ui.always-include=true
apikey=mysecret
quarkus.container-image.group=redhat_sa_france
quarkus.container-image.registry=quay.io
-quarkus.datasource.db-kind=mysql
+quarkus.datasource.db-kind=postgresql
%dev.quarkus.datasource.username=antennas
%dev.quarkus.datasource.password=antennas
-%dev.quarkus.datasource.jdbc.url=jdbc:mysql://localhost:3306/antennas
+%dev.quarkus.datasource.jdbc.url=jdbc:postgresql://localhost:5432/antennas
quarkus.hibernate-orm.database.generation=drop-and-create
%dev.quarkus.http.port=8081
version=2
diff --git a/src/main/resources/dataset-prod.sql b/src/main/resources/dataset-prod.sql
index 7d77a27..bae962b 100644
--- a/src/main/resources/dataset-prod.sql
+++ b/src/main/resources/dataset-prod.sql
@@ -1,11 +1,12 @@
-INSERT IGNORE INTO Incident
+INSERT INTO Incident
(
id, date, description, status
)
VALUES
- (1, "2022-10-21", "coupure fibre, paris", 0),
- (2, "2022-10-20", "coupure fibre, marseille", 1),
- (3, "2022-10-22", "panne émetteur, brest", 0),
- (4, "2022-10-23", "panne émetteur, metz", 1),
- (5, "2022-10-24", "panne émetteur, strasbourg", 1),
- (6, "2022-10-25", "panne de courant, bourges", 0);
+ (1, '2022-10-21', 'coupure fibre, paris', FALSE),
+ (2, '2022-10-20', 'coupure fibre, marseille', TRUE),
+ (3, '2022-10-22', 'panne émetteur, brest', FALSE),
+ (4, '2022-10-23', 'panne émetteur, metz', TRUE),
+ (5, '2022-10-24', 'panne émetteur, strasbourg', TRUE),
+ (6, '2022-10-25', 'panne de courant, bourges', FALSE)
+ON CONFLICT DO NOTHING;
diff --git a/src/main/resources/dataset.sql b/src/main/resources/dataset.sql
index 3af1706..429045e 100644
--- a/src/main/resources/dataset.sql
+++ b/src/main/resources/dataset.sql
@@ -1,8 +1,9 @@
-INSERT IGNORE INTO Incident
+INSERT INTO Incident
(
id, date, description, status
)
VALUES
- (1, "2022-10-21", "coupure fibre", 0),
- (2, "2022-10-22", "panne émetteur", 0),
- (3, "2022-10-22", "le datacenter a grillé", 0);
+ (1, '2022-10-21', 'coupure fibre', FALSE),
+ (2, '2022-10-22', 'panne émetteur', FALSE),
+ (3, '2022-10-22', 'le datacenter a grillé', FALSE)
+ON CONFLICT DO NOTHING;